Subject: [slubll1 07/19] slub: Move page->frozen handling near where the page->freelist handling occurs
Date: Wed, 30 Mar 2011 15:23:49 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20110330202419.431478190@linux.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: 20110330202342.669400887@linux.com
[-- Attachment #1: frozen_move --]
[-- Type: text/plain, Size: 2324 bytes --]
This is necessary because the frozen bit has to be handled in the same cmpxchg_double
with the freelist and the counters.
